Output d581bae7b9fc38607b659821a10530e7abb0c83f42e7e474d388b902e1098eb0:0

value
762459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7ab02e8311e27795def0b8777cec9a9582a5d06 OP_EQUAL
address
3QGZh18rfkfah4qJWhgmYKxWE5suUWfEGe
transaction
d581bae7b9fc38607b659821a10530e7abb0c83f42e7e474d388b902e1098eb0
confirmations
144182
spent
true